WebMar 23, 2007 · Examples include manure stored in an uncovered lagoon, or other residuals disposed in landfills. When these residuals are composted instead, it is possible to qualify for methane avoidance credits if the material is used or stabilized in a way that releases significantly less methane into the atmosphere.
